Chelsea deny interest in Milan star
By European Football
July 27 2005
Chelsea have taken the unusual step of issuing a statement denying their interest in AC Milan striker Andrei Shevchenko. The statement reads:
"It is club policy not to comment on speculation linking Chelsea to players."
"However there are continuing, and totally incorrect, reports regarding Andrei Shevchenko that only serve to unnecessarily destabilise those players already at Chelsea.
"The club has made it quite clear that we are seeking to bring in one more player, and we have also made it clear that this will be a midfield player, if it happens.
"We are not seeking to sign a forward and we have total confidence in those we have."
This midfielder would of course be Lyon’s Essien, who Chelsea are hoping to land this week, despite Lyon being desperate to hang onto their star player.
